Windows系统下MySQL部署指南

资源类型:klfang.com 2025-06-14 22:48

mysql部署windows简介:



MySQL在Windows系统的高效部署指南 在当今的信息技术领域中,数据库管理系统(DBMS)扮演着至关重要的角色

    MySQL,作为一款开源的关系型数据库管理系统(RDBMS),凭借其高性能、可靠性和灵活性,广泛应用于各类应用场景中

    对于在Windows系统上部署MySQL的用户来说,一个正确的部署流程不仅能确保数据库的稳定运行,还能为后续的数据库管理和优化打下坚实基础

    本文旨在提供一份详尽且高效的MySQL在Windows系统上的部署指南,帮助用户顺利完成安装与配置

     一、准备工作 在部署MySQL之前,用户需要做好以下准备工作: 1.系统要求:确保Windows系统满足MySQL的最低硬件和软件要求

    通常,MySQL支持Windows7及以上版本的操作系统

     2.下载安装包:访问MySQL的官方网站(【https://dev.mysql.com/downloads/mysql/】(https://dev.mysql.com/downloads/mysql/)),选择适合Windows系统的安装包

    对于大多数用户而言,推荐下载.msi格式的安装包,因为它提供了图形化的安装向导,简化了安装过程

     3.规划安装路径:考虑MySQL的安装路径和数据存放路径

    为了系统安全和性能考虑,建议将数据存放路径设置在非系统盘(如D盘)

     二、安装MySQL 1.运行安装包:双击下载的.msi安装包文件,启动MySQL的安装向导

     2.选择安装类型:在安装向导中,用户可以选择“Typical”(典型安装)或“Custom”(自定义安装)

    典型安装将按照默认设置安装MySQL,而自定义安装允许用户手动指定安装路径和配置参数

    对于需要特定配置的用户,建议选择自定义安装

     3.配置参数:在自定义安装过程中,用户需要设置一些关键参数,包括MySQL的安装路径、数据存放路径、服务配置类型、端口号等

    建议遵循以下原则进行配置: - 安装路径:选择一个非系统盘的位置,以减少系统盘的空间占用

     - 数据存放路径:同样选择非系统盘,以提高数据的安全性和性能

     - 服务配置类型:根据实际需求选择“Developer Default”(开发者默认)或“Server Default”(服务器默认)

     - 端口号:默认情况下,MySQL使用3306端口

    如果该端口已被其他应用占用,用户需要选择一个未被占用的端口

     4.设置管理员账户:在安装过程中,用户需要设置MySQL的管理员用户名和密码

    这是访问和管理MySQL数据库的关键凭证,务必牢记并妥善保管

     5.完成安装:按照安装向导的提示,完成剩余的安装步骤

    安装完成后,MySQL服务将自动注册为Windows服务,并在系统启动时自动运行

     三、配置环境变量 为了方便在命令行中访问MySQL,用户需要将MySQL的安装路径添加到系统的环境变量中

    具体步骤如下: 1.复制MySQL的bin目录路径:进入MySQL的安装路径,找到MySQL Server X.X文件夹下的bin文件夹,并复制其路径

     2.编辑系统环境变量:右键点击“此电脑”(或“计算机”),选择“属性”->“高级系统设置”->“环境变量”

    在系统变量中找到“Path”,并点击“编辑”

     3.添加MySQL的bin目录路径:在“编辑环境变量”窗口中,点击“新建”,并粘贴之前复制的MySQL的bin目录路径

    点击“确定”保存更改

     完成以上步骤后,用户可以在任意位置的命令行中输入“mysql --version”来检查MySQL的安装和配置是否正确

    如果显示MySQL的版本信息,则说明安装和配置成功

     四、登录和管理MySQL 1.登录MySQL:在命令行中输入“mysql -uroot -p”,并按回车键

    系统将提示用户输入管理员账户的密码

    输入密码后,用户即可登录MySQL数据库

     2.管理MySQL:登录后,用户可以使用MySQL提供的命令行工具来执行各种数据库操作,如创建数据库、创建表、插入数据、查询数据等

    此外,用户还可以使用图形化的数据库管理工具(如DBeaver)来连接和管理MySQL数据库

     五、优化与维护 为了确保MySQL的稳定运行和高效性能,用户需要定期进行数据库的优化和维护工作

    以下是一些建议: 1.定期备份数据:使用MySQL提供的备份工具(如mysqldump)定期备份数据库,以防止数据丢失或损坏

     2.优化配置文件:根据实际需求调整MySQL的配置文件(如my.ini),以提高数据库的性能和稳定性

    例如,可以增加缓冲区大小、调整日志记录级别等

     3.监控数据库性能:使用MySQL提供的性能监控工具(如SHOW STATUS、SHOW VARIABLES等)或第三方监控工具来监控数据库的性能指标,如查询响应时间、连接数等

    根据监控结果及时调整数据库配置和优化查询语句

     4.定期维护数据库:使用MySQL提供的维护工具(如mysqlcheck)定期检查和维护数据库表,确保其完整性和性能

     六、安全注意事项 在部署MySQL时,用户还需要关注数据库的安全性

    以下是一些建议的安全措施: 1.强密码策略:确保管理员账户和其他重要用户账户设置复杂且强的密码

    定期更换密码,并避免在多个系统或服务中使用相同的密码

     2.限制数据库用户权限:只授予用户执行其任务所需的最小权限

    避免给普通用户授予过高的权限,以减少潜在的安全风险

     3.禁用远程root登录:为了减少潜在的安全风险,建议禁用远程root登录功能

    用户可以通过修改MySQL的配置文件或使用防火墙规则来实现这一点

     4.启用日志记录:启用MySQL的错误日志、查询日志等日志记录功能,以便于追踪和排查问题以及检测异常活动

    定期审查日志文件,及时发现并处理潜在的安全威胁

     5.及时更新MySQL版本:及时关注MySQL的官方更新和补丁信息,并定期更新MySQL版本以获取最新的安全补丁和功能改进

     综上所述,MySQL在Windows系统上的部署过程虽然涉及多个步骤和配置项,但只要用户遵循本文提供的指南和建议进行操作,就能顺利完成安装与配置工作,并确保数据库的稳定运行和高效性能

    同时,用户还需要关注数据库的安全性和维护工作,以确保数据的完整性和安全性

    

阅读全文
上一篇:MySQL为何采用全文索引:提升文本搜索效率的关键

最新收录:

  • MySQL5.7.21驱动详解与应用指南
  • MySQL为何采用全文索引:提升文本搜索效率的关键
  • MySQL密码遗忘?快速找回攻略!
  • MySQL高效读取技巧大揭秘
  • MySQL存储过程:优化数据库操作的创意实践
  • 项目配置MySQL URL指南
  • MySQL批量多表插入记录技巧
  • MySQL视图创建要点解析
  • MySQL分库解除策略实战指南
  • MySQL存储过程错误处理全攻略
  • MySQL客户端:轻松修改字符集指南
  • MySQL高效查询:掌握<> NOT IN技巧
  • 首页 | mysql部署windows:Windows系统下MySQL部署指南